About Linde:Linde is a leading global industrial gases and engineering company with 2023 sales of $33 billion. We live our mission of making our world more productive every day by providing high-quality solutions, technologies and services which are making our customers more successful and helping to sustain and protect our planet.The company serves a variety of end markets includingchemicals,energy & decarbonization,food & beverage,electronics,healthcare,manufacturing,metals & mining. Linde's industrial gases are used in countless applications, from life-saving oxygen for hospitals to high-purity & specialty gases for electronics manufacturing, hydrogenfor clean fuels and much more. Linde also delivers state-of-the-art gas processing solutions to support customer expansion, efficiency improvements, and emissions reductions. For more information about the company and its products and services, please visit www.linde.com.Job Overview: We are seeking an Engineer for our Wooster, Ohio locationResponsible for coordination and implementation of moderately complex engineering projects in accordance with Linde policies. Core focus will be to carry products from development through commercialization of cryogenic technologies in the food industry. Additional opportunity in gas technologies for pharmaceuticals and wastewater may also be applied.Scope: This position works under general supervision utilizing diversified procedures and standards. Candidate has mastered a mechanical engineering skill-set and maintains a thorough knowledge of new developments and technology. Heavily involved in pre- and post-sale support of commercial applications.Primary Responsibilities:

  • Evaluate projects return on investment to justify capital expenditures
  • Work closely with OEMs on the integration of Linde's Unique freezing and cooling technology
  • Work closely with Marketing on the launch of new product development programs
  • Demonstrates creativity and ingenuity in applying engineering principles and practices
  • Develops, selects and implements engineering techniques and solutions to solve difficult problems
  • Participates in defining engineering approaches and in planning, prioritizing and scheduling work for design team
  • Performs engineering calculations for accurate sizing of customer specific cooling and freezing applications.
  • Ensures successful completion of assigned project phases within the budgeted time and cost constraints
  • Prioritizes work and prepares engineering plans accurately
  • Reviews and checks project specific drawings and data sheets to ensure compliance with design criteria and standards
  • Influences team members and promotes ideas to improve design and implantation practices
  • Analyze cost and benefits of various solutions, followed by appropriate recommendations
  • Will lead field teams through installations, startups and issue identification, analysis and repairs related to primary skill area
  • Interfaces with internal and external customers/suppliers
  • May provide technical and engineering support to Linde regions
  • Provides technical guidance to other professionals
  • Directs preparation of appropriate documentation for assigned project phases and prepares required reports and summaries to communicate project progress or results
  • Travel to customer sites and equipment fabricators as required
  • Work with technicians to facilitate completion of design and fabrication. Qualifications:
    • BS Degree in engineering (mechanical or Industrial preferred). Managerial experience or an MBA.
    • A minimum of five (5) years overall experience in applications and / or design engineering (preferably in food applications)
    • Able to read, understand and modify electrical schematics fluidly
    • Must have proficiency in a CAD platform; strong familiarity with AutoDesk Inventor 2020 preferred
    • Must have an understanding of PLC programming and ladder logic, Allen Bradley RS Logix and Siemens a plus
    • Experience in supervision of technical teams and projects strongly preferred
    • Must be able to travel approximately 40%
    • Familiarity with applications in cryogenic and other relevant process industries is highly desirable
    • Experience in equipment design and manufacturing
    • Project management experience highly desirable
    • Background in new equipment and applications commercialization strongly preferred
    • Must be able to articulately communicate ideas to others across different levels inside and outside the organization.
    • Knowledge of how businesses operate; keenly aware of how strategies and decisions affect success of projects.
    • Familiarity of USDA, NSF a plus, but not required
    • AutoCad Electrical a plus
